James Barton, almost certainly a brother of Lt. Col. Joseph Barton, died
after 1798. He married, 20 May 1759, Elizabeth Westbrook, daughter of
Richard (Dirk) Westbrook and his wife Janneke, of Sussex County, NJ.
James and Elizabeth were grantors in Sussex in 1765, and he may have been
the James, "late of New Jersey", who was grantee in 1791, and the James
who advertised land for sale in Ulster County in 1798 (Rising Sun of
Kingston, 13 Jan. 1798). The family lived at the Wallpack area and
belonged to the Dutch Church there. Some of the Dutch records give the
surname as "Bartron", "Barthron", etc. but there is sufficient evidence
to make certain that these are misspellings of "Barton" and not another
name.

This James did have a daughter Sarah, b. about 1776; m. Thomas Brink.

Other children are Daniel, Mary, Blandina, Lydia, David, Jane, James
(bapt 8 June 1777) and Richard.
